Methods to Copy a Course | Blackboard Help.

  • On the Administrator Panel in the Courses section, select Courses.
  • On the Courses page, select Copy Course.
  • Select the type of copy to perform.
  • Type the course ID in Source Course ID box. If you don't know the course ID, select Browse to launch the search window. Select the course and select ...
  • Type the course ID in the Destination Course ID box. If this course doesn't already exist, Blackboard Learn creates a new course with the course ID ...
  • Select Submit.

How do I copy a folder from one course to another in Blackboard?

In the Content Collection, go to the folder that contains the file or folder you want to copy. Select the check box next to the item and select Copy. You can also access the Copy option in the item's menu. Enter the path to the destination folder or select Browse to locate and select the destination folder.
